Whatever You Do, Do All to the Glory of God, (sculpture).
Artist:
Hardin, Adlai Stevenson, 1901- , sculptor.
Title:
Whatever You Do, Do All to the Glory of God, (sculpture).
Medium:
Carved linden wood appliqued to cherry panels.
Dimensions:
H. 11 ft. L. 16 ft.
Inscription:
(Proper left of sculpture:) WHATEVER YOU DO/DO ALL TO THE GLORY OF GOD
Description:
A formalized tree shape, with a family group as its base, depicts nineteen occupations. These include a doctor and nurse, postman, tailor, fisherman, scientist, teacher and pupils, musician, waitress, businessman, secretary, farmer and his wife, butcher, carpenter, cleaning woman, steelworker, draftsman, minister and builder.
